Harry C. Stuchal

Harry C. Stuchal, 55, of Harmony Road, Slippery Rock, died at 7:06 p.m. Sunday at UPMC Pittsburgh.
Born June 26, 1955, in Grove City, he was the son of Charles E. Stuchal and Betty A. (Riley) Stuchal.
A 1974 graduate of Butler High School, he was a mechanic for Slippery Rock University, retiring in 2009 with more than 30 years of service. He was active in farming with his brother and nephew. He also was known by many for hauling livestock.
He was a very active supporter of 4-H activities in many capacities, a member of the Pennsylvania Holstein Association and a former member of the Marion Township Fire Department.
He always was willing to help others and was known for his sense of humor.
Surviving are a brother, Richard W. Stuchal and his wife, Linda, of Slippery Rock; a niece, Lisa Bauer and her husband, Jim; a nephew, Cory Stuchal and his wife, Nikole; a great-niece, Skylar Bauer; two great-nephews, Jesse and Jimi Bauer; an aunt and an uncle.
He was preceded in death by his parents, a sister, a brother and a niece.
